Data Warehouse Testing
Data warehouse testing is essential in the running of a successful and accurate data warehouse. A data warehouse is basically a storage place for data that is analyzed, archived, and secured. These data warehouses are used to manage large amounts of data and make it easy for users to comprehend. Without the right testing, a data warehouse could give wrong answers and cause its users to become uncertain and unconfident of its accuracy. So how does the testing work when it comes to data warehousing? In order for testing to work appropriately, the right people and knowledge are needed. Having the correct technology is important as well. Once you have the right group of testers for a data warehouse the job will get done.
There are many important tasks involved with the data warehouse testing process. First, all the analysts must collect the necessary documents. Then plan tests and scripts must be improved and performed. Test environments should be set up correctly. User acceptance tests should also be performed. QA testers are needed for the process of creating the test plans and scripts. OA testers are quality assurance testers. There are indeed different tests that can be performed on data warehouses to show the quality of the of the system and how it can perform with large amounts of data. Data warehouse testing methodology is very important. Some of these tests are called extraction performance test, transformation test, and analytics test. These are just three of the several data warehouse testing categories.
There are also tests such as loading tests, down stream flow tests, parallel tests, one time population tests, security framework tests, and stress and volume tests among others. Each of these tests have their own individual set of tasks that are performed to ensure that the data warehousing is successful. ETL testing is testing that is extremely important in data warehousing. The three letters stand for extract, transform, and load.
Extraction tests are necessary to ensure that the data is able to extract the essential fields. This type of test also checks to see that the extraction logic for each source structure operates properly. Extraction tests make sure the extraction is finished on time. Transformation testing is a bit different with its tasks. Transformation tests check to see if detailed and combined data sets are created and corresponding. This test also checks to make sure that no thief of data happens during the testing process. It also makes sure transformation is finished on time. And then there are the loading tests. Loading testing is necessary to ensure that there is no thief of info during the loading process. It checks to see if transformations work properly during this process. It also makes sure that the data sets are working properly. Loading tests also help to see that past snap shops function correctly. It makes sure that the loading is happening at its expected time. Due to the intricacy of these tests, there can be disadvantages such as having to adjust to the system or technology. And there are many types of data warehouse models out there.
With data warehousing being used within so many businesses, of course there will always be available jobs within this field. Data warehousing is used in many popular business such as hospitals and banks. If you would like to seek employment in data warehouse testing, you will definitely need to be prepared in the best way possible. One of the ways to prepare is to practice answering some possible data warehouse testing interview questions. There is no way to be sure which questions will be asked on an interview. But you can still be ready. Some useful questions you might ask yourself in preparation might be describe a fact table or what is a star schema. If you are in need of practice the internet is the perfect place to start. Just do a web search for interview questions for potential data warehouse testing employees. You are of course sure to find some useful questions to ask yourself in preparation of an interview.
A web search can also help you in your search to find jobs in data warehouse testing. It is all at your fingertips. The important thing is that you are first skilled and knowledgeable about what it takes to run a successful data warehouse. After that, the rest is up to you. You have to know a great deal about data warehousing in general to know how the testing process works. It is best not to apply to any jobs unless you are sure you are an expert. Until then, you will not be the best candidate for the job. There are many intricate details within the several data warehouse tests. All of these unique testing process work to achieve one main goal: to make sure that everything is operating properly within the data warehouse. There may be many challenges along the way of the testing process. But testing of the data warehouse is used only for positive results. Overall data warehouse testing is essential in progressing the value of a data warehouse.
